Differentiating Between The Gaming As Well As The Normal Laptops
People specially the youngsters are getting highly passionate about gaming and a lot of them are also taking up gaming as their profession. Looking at this seriousness, a lot of leading brands that manufacture laptops are showing a fast drift towards the Gaming laptops South Africa. Normal people who do not have a craving for the gamings often are not able to understand the increasing fling towards the gaming laptops. There are a lot of differences between the gaming laptops and the normal laptops. As we proceed in this write up, we will be discussing various points that specify the differences between the two categories of laptops.
The first and the most important thing that differentiates between the two categories of laptops is the graphic card. In a normal laptop which is used for official work or educational use does not need a high definition graphic card. But when it comes to a gaming laptop, a graphic card of a good brand and good specification is a must. Having a good amount of dedicated RAM is very important for a laptop. This requirement increases to a huge extent when we talk about the gaming laptop. In normal laptops, the 2GB or the 4GB RAM is considered to be very good. But for a gaming laptop, the requirements are quite high. The minimum requirement of a gaming laptop in context to the RAM is 4 GB. With the help of good amount of RAM, the laptop will run smoothly irrespective of the specs of the game.
Most of the normal laptops these days either come with a dual core or quad core processor. However, there are a lot of gaming laptops who have introduced octa- core processors as well in the gaming laptops to make gaming a great experience. These processors help the load of the game in getting shredded and help the system run smoothly. In comparison to the normal laptops, the gaming laptops are much high in terms or screen resolution as well. Most of the games these days are 3 dimensional and therefore having the best screen resolution that is compatible with the game’s features is a must.
Some of the other features that help in differentiating between the two categories of laptops include the specifications of the web cam, the type and number of USB slots; the battery related performance as well as the audio capacity of the system. A good microphone port and good quality speaker is a must for the gaming laptop while there is no such case for the normal laptops.
